ravi ranjan resume

5
RAVI RANJAN Citizenship: India Date of birth: 20 th Jan, 1990 Contact Mobile : +91- 9840020994 E-mail : [email protected] Address for Communication : C/o Maa Durga PG Accomodations, 3/530 VPG Avenue, 1st Street, Mettukuppam, OMR, Chennai - 600097 Career Abstract Competent & diligent professional having around 3 years of experience in Datawarehouse Projects basically with HealthCare. Currently Associated with Cognizant Technology Soultions as Programmer Analyst. Experience in ETL Tool Informatica in Designing workflows, mappings, configuring the informatica server and scheduling the workflows and sessions using Informatica Power center 9.6.0/9.6.1. Good Knowledge in Teradata having experience in Teradata performance Tuning and using different Teradata utilities like FastLoad, MultiLoad, BTEQ Experience in both development and Support Project in Datawarehouse. Experience Details Presently working in Cognizant Technology Solutions India Pvt. Ltd. , Chennai as Programmer Analyst (Since 28 th Feb, 2014 Till Date). Associate - Network Management in Wipro Infotech Ltd., Gurgaon (21 st Oct, 2013 21 st Feb, 2014). Project 1 Title : BCBS-MN DW FOUNDATION Client : BCBS-MN Operating System : UNIX, Mainframe (CA 7) Tools : TERADATA 13, Informatica Power Center 8/9, Mainframe CA7 Team Size : 50 Role : Team Member (Developer) Period : July 2014Present Responsibilities Monitoring around 50 assets (approx. 300+ workflows). It includes daily/weekly/monthly/adhoc runs. Production Incidents: TYPE 1- Production Run Incidents: Workflow failed during run or didn’t start as expected. The root cause of the trouble needs to be identified and if possible has to be rectified such that the same error never occurs again TYPE 2- Production Data Incidents: After the data goes Live, the business/Certification team raises objections on the authenticity/accuracy of the data being loaded into the tables. These objections/alerts have to be verified for their validity and if found to be a bug, then this issue is promoted to the status: Production Ticket (or) Production Incident.

Upload: ravi-ranjan

Post on 18-Jan-2017

40 views

Category:

Documents


1 download

TRANSCRIPT

Page 1: ravi ranjan resume

RAVI RANJAN Citizenship: India ▪ Date of birth: 20th Jan, 1990

Contact

Mobile : +91- 9840020994

E-mail : [email protected]

Address for Communication :

C/o Maa Durga PG Accomodations, 3/530 VPG Avenue, 1st Street, Mettukuppam, OMR, Chennai - 600097

Career Abstract

Competent & diligent professional having around 3 years of experience in Datawarehouse Projects

basically with HealthCare.

Currently Associated with Cognizant Technology Soultions as Programmer Analyst.

Experience in ETL Tool Informatica in Designing workflows, mappings, configuring the informatica server

and scheduling the workflows and sessions using Informatica Power center 9.6.0/9.6.1.

Good Knowledge in Teradata having experience in Teradata performance Tuning and using different

Teradata utilities like FastLoad, MultiLoad, BTEQ

Experience in both development and Support Project in Datawarehouse.

Experience Details

Presently working in Cognizant Technology Solutions India Pvt. Ltd. , Chennai as Programmer Analyst

(Since 28th Feb, 2014 – Till Date).

Associate - Network Management in Wipro Infotech Ltd., Gurgaon (21st Oct, 2013 – 21st Feb, 2014).

Project 1

Title : BCBS-MN DW FOUNDATION

Client : BCBS-MN

Operating System : UNIX, Mainframe (CA 7)

Tools : TERADATA 13, Informatica Power Center 8/9, Mainframe CA7

Team Size : 50

Role : Team Member (Developer)

Period : July 2014– Present

Responsibilities

Monitoring around 50 assets (approx. 300+ workflows). It includes daily/weekly/monthly/adhoc runs.

Production Incidents:

TYPE 1- Production Run Incidents: Workflow failed during run or didn’t start as expected. The root cause

of the trouble needs to be identified and if possible has to be rectified such that the same error never

occurs again

TYPE 2- Production Data Incidents: After the data goes Live, the business/Certification team raises

objections on the authenticity/accuracy of the data being loaded into the tables. These

objections/alerts have to be verified for their validity and if found to be a bug, then this issue is

promoted to the status: Production Ticket (or) Production Incident.

Page 2: ravi ranjan resume

Production Fixes:

For the above 2 types of incidents, we usually have 2 fixes

TYPE 1- History Fix : This involves updating the target tables such that the erroneous data is either

removed and/or updated such that it is in sync with the business requirements

TYPE 2- Incremental Fix: This involves updating the logic in the Informatica Mapping Designer and

Workflow Manager so that the data would be populated correctly into the target tables.

Process Flow for fixes:

After the issue/incident is verified, the following is done

The workflow/mapping components are copied from the Production Environment into the Development

Environment.

The code changes are made.

Testing is done to check the accuracy of the data and performance of the system.

Upon successful completion of the above, the code is sent to the Business SIT team for testing the

accuracy of the data.

Upon successful completion of the above, the code is migrated to Integration environment.

The workflow is run and the data is loaded into the target tables. Again the Business SIT team validates

the data.

Upon successful completion of the above, the code is migrated to Production Environment.

The workflow run is monitored for 1-2 loads and if the data is found to be error free, then the ticket (incident) is

closed for that incident.

Organization: Cognizant Technology Solutions India Pvt. Ltd.

Customer Profile:

• Highmark is like a third party company, BCBSMN has decided to migrate its strategic IT assets to Highmark’s

Blue Core Platform. The functions that were handling by Blue cross will be taken care of High mark in future.

• Under the initiative of ‘Operating Model Transformation’ (OMT), all groups will be migrated in phases. BCBSMN

Datawarehouse will get the migrated data from Highmark and this data will be loaded in newly created Analytical

Information Datawarehouse (AIW) to support EDIM’s Downstream Data Consumers (submissions, neighborhoods

and reporting).

• In BCBSMN there are many domains like Membership, claims, Client, Product, etc., BCBSMN is selling these

domain information to HM.

• And the first and fore most thing that BCBSMN sends is the Conversion data of Member information to Highmark

so that they will generate Client IDs so as to maintain it.

Project 2:

Company name : Cognizant Technology Solutions

Project Title : CMR (CMDM Inbound)

Role : ETL Developer

Client : Blue Cross Blue Shield of Minnesota (BCBSMN)

Environment : Teradata, Informatica, Wherescape, Unix.

Duration : From April 2015 to November 2015

Page 3: ravi ranjan resume

Project Description:

CMR ETL loads Alineo Reporting Extracts Files into SDS and CMR tables. The CMR is a replication of MeDecision’s

Alineo’s Cache database normalized to Blue Cross Blue Shield of Minnesota structures using Blue Cross Blue Shield

of Minnesota naming.

Since BlueCross can neither access the Alineo databases directly nor is the database design under our control,

BlueCross has decided to create a replication of the database within our data center using our business-model-

based design.

In a simple term, CMR is a repository that contains all the information of Patients and doctors as well as their

medicine’s information.

Roles & Responsibilities:

• Being in a two member team has given me an opportunity to take the responsibilities of the project activities from

Analyzing of logical requirements, Designing, Developing, Unit Testing, Functional Testing, and Defect Fixing,

Document preparation for Migration and Production support.

• Designed and developed ETL codes using both Informatica & Wherescape tool.

• Prepared all the documents right from the Requirement Clarification document, Data Analysis from Data Model,

High Level Design document, Low level Design document, and Coding Standards document, Estimation for

developers for ETL objects, MOM and Deployment document.

• Solved data and ETL issues in testing phase.

Project 3:

Company name : Cognizant Technology Solutions

Project Title : PPL I Automate (Outbound)

Role : Developer

Client : Blue Cross Blue Shield of Minnesota (BCBSMN)

Environment : Teradata, Informatica

Duration : From December 2015 to June 2016

Project Description:

the claim was it through Industry Accident, Auto Accident or other means

like Auto insurance

Roles & Responsibilities:

• Being in a two member team has given me an opportunity to take the responsibilities of the project activities from

Analyzing of logical requirements, Designing, Developing, Unit Testing, Functional Testing, and Defect Fixing,

Document preparation for Migration and Production support.

• Designed and developed ETL codes using Informatica tool.

• Prepared all the documents right from the Requirement Clarification document, Data Analysis from Data Model,

High Level Design document, Low level Design document, and Coding Standards document, Estimation for

developers for ETL objects, MOM and Deployment document.

• Solved data and ETL issues in testing phase.

Page 4: ravi ranjan resume

Project 4:

Company name : Cognizant Technology Solutions

Project Title : Excellus health Plan

Role : ETL Developer

Client : Excellus Health Plan Inc.

Environment : Teradata, Informatica

Duration : From July 2016 to August 2016

Project Description:

The EHP Interfaces development is essentially a transformation program with vision of improvement in

simplification in product, platform (use of single platform i.e. Facets) and process, reduction of cost, employee

satisfaction, to have a centralized system like Facets and reduce operational cost. Existing Excellus Health plan was

on mainframe systems initially.

Client Description:

Excellus Health Plan Inc. is a company committed to providing affordable, results-oriented team players who want

to be part of this progressive organization and help us achieve our goals in satisfying our customers and building a

diverse workforce. Excellus Health Plan offers challenging opportunities in a wide range of areas including Actuarial

Services, Information Technology, Customer Service, Medical Case Management, Utilization Review, Sales,

Marketing, Finance and Accounting, Human Resources, Administrative Services, and Claims Processing. Excellus

health plan extends or markets into major part central NY, central NY southern tier, Rochester and Utica region of

USA.

Previously, the company's BlueCross BlueShield operations were known as: BlueCross BlueShield of Central New

York, BlueCross BlueShield of the Rochester Area, and BlueCross BlueShield of UticaWatertown.

Roles and Responsibilities:

logical requirements, Designing, Developing, Unit Testing, Functional Testing, and Defect Fixing, Document

preparation for Migration and Production support.

document, Estimation for developers for ETL objects and Deployment document.

Professional Synopsis

Strong analytical, problem solving & organizational skills

Adept at handling the SDLC involving requirement study, analysis, design, development.

An effective hard worker with excellent interpersonal skills.

Possess excellent communication, problem solving , leadership, Team Building and Presentation Skills.

Educational Details

B. Tech. (CSE) from Delhi College of Technology & Management, Faridabad, Haryana 70.8%

Maharshi Dayanand University, Rohtak, Haryana 2008 -12

Page 5: ravi ranjan resume

Personal Profile

Father’s Name : Pashupati Nath Prasad

Languages Known : Hindi, English

Current Employee : Cognizant

Current Designation : Programmer Analyst

Notice Period : 60 days

Ready to Relocate : Yes

Declaration

I, Ravi Ranjan, hereby declare that the information furnished above is true to the best in my Knowledge and belief.

Place: Chennai

Dated: (Ravi Ranjan)